Iodine deficiency leads to a decrease in the intellectual potential of the entire population living in the zone of iodine deficiency.
Increased physical fatigue, inability to concentrate for a long time, progressive visual and hearing impairments are just a small part of all the ailments that iodine deficiency can cause in an adult.
Supplemental intake of foods containing iodine is one way to avoid iodine deficiency.
Kelp is the common name for all varieties of marine large brown algae: digitata kelp, Japanese and sugar kelp, sea kale, growing off the coast of the Atlantic and Pacific oceans.
